Ativation d'une feuille avec VBA

Résolu
lou3313 -  
 lou3313 -
Bonjour,

Pouvez- vous m'indiquez, la démarche à suivre suivant les indications ci-après.

Je suis sur la feuille 1.
Je voudrais écrire sur BVA, la formule suivante.
Si dans ma feuille 1, je clique sur la cellule A1, alors doit s'afficher la feuille 2.

Je sais qu'il est facile de le faire par le lien hypertexte ou avec une macro, mais ce n'est pas toujours fiable.
Tandis que sur BVA une fois que c'est écrit cela fonctionne parfaitement.

Merci d'avance pour votre aide.


A voir également:

1 réponse

g Messages postés 1285 Statut Membre 577
 
Bonjour,

Private Sub Worksheet_SelectionChange(ByVal Target As Excel.Range) 
If Target.Address = "$A$1" Then 
Sheets("Feuil2").Activate 
End If 
End Sub 

A copier dans le module de feuille.

Bonne journée.
0
lou3313
 
Bonjour,
Je m'excuse du retard pour te répondre, mais j'étais absent.
j'ai copié ta procédure sur le code de la feuille 1 et cela ne fonctionne pas.
Ai-je commis une erreur? si oui, peux tu m'indiquer la démarche a suivre.
Merci encore pour ta réponse.
Merci et à plus.
0
g Messages postés 1285 Statut Membre 577
 
J'ai testé, cela fonctionne. Voir fichier joint :https://www.cjoint.com/?BDwasii0PFP
Bonne suite.
0
lou3313
 
Bonjour,
Effectivement cela fonctionne.
Encore merci, pour ton suivi.
Cordialement
0